Abstract

Disclosed herein are a new phenylacetate derivative represented by Chemical Formula 1 or p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, a preparation method thereof, and a composition for prevention or treatment of diseases induced by the activation of T-type calcium ion channels containing the same. The composition containing the phenylacetate derivative according to the present invention effectively inhibits the activation of T-type calcium ion channels and may be useful in the prevention or treatment of diseases such as hypertension, cancer, epilepsy, and neurogenic pains induced by the activation of T-type calcium ion channels. wherein, X, R 1 , and R 3 are as defined herein.

5. A method for preparing the phenylacetate derivative of claim 1 as represented by the following Chemical Formula 1, comprising:

preparing an ester compound of Chemical Formula 3 by esterification reaction of a carboxyl acid compound of Chemical Formula 2 as a starting material in the presence of an acid catalyst (Step 1);

preparing a compound of Chemical Formula 4 by reacting the compound of Chemical Formula 3 obtained from step 1 with t-butoxide and isopropyl bromide (Step 2);

preparing a compound of Chemical Formula 5 by reacting the compound of Chemical Formula 4 obtained from step 2 with 1,3-dibromopropane (Step 3); and

preparing a compound of Chemical Formula 1 by reacting the compound of Chemical Formula 5 obtained from step 3 with a compound of Chemical Formula 6 (Step 4),

wherein, R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, R 4 , and X are as defined in claim 1 .

6. The method as set forth in claim 5 , wherein, in Step 1, after the carboxyl acid compound of Chemical Formula 2 is dissolved in methanol, the compound of Chemical Formula 3 is obtained by heating or refluxing the mixture at 85-95° C. in the presence of sulfuric acid for 2-4 hours.

7. The method as set forth in claim 5 , wherein, in Step 2, after the compound of Chemical Formula 3 and t-butoxide is dissolved in anhydrous dimethylformamide, the compound of Chemical Formula 4 is obtained by adding isopropyl bromide into the mixture and stirring the mixture at room temperature for 2-4 hours.

8. The method as set forth in claim 5 , wherein, in Step 3, after a solution of n-butyllithium in hexane is added to a solution of diisopropylamine in anhydrous tetrahydrofuran at −75-−80° C., the compound of Chemical Formula 5 is obtained by adding the compound of Chemical Formula 4 to the tetrahydrofuran solution with stirring, adding 1,3-dibromopropane dropwise to the tetrahydrofuran solution, and stirring the solution at room temperature overnight.

9. The method as set forth in claim 5 , wherein, in Step 4 when the compound of Chemical Formula 5 is reacted with the compound of Chemical Formula 6, the compound of Chemical Formula 1 is obtained by dissolving the compound of Chemical Formula 5 into methanol, adding the compound of Chemical Formula 6 and potassium carbonate, and heating or refluxing the mixture at 85-95° C. for 2-4 hours.
